Creating a car animation with VFX in a realistic environment can be an exciting project! Whether you're aiming for a high-speed chase, a sleek car showcase, or a dramatic scene, several key elements contribute to the success of the animation. Here’s a breakdown of the essential components:
1. Car Model
Realistic Modeling: The car model should have a high level of detail, including accurate body lines, textures, and materials.
Materials and Shaders: Use realistic shaders for paint, glass, rubber, and metal components. Proper reflection and refraction settings can make the car look more lifelike.
2. Environment
Urban/Rural Settings: Depending on the theme, you can set your car in an urban cityscape, a rural road, or even a racetrack.
Lighting: Natural lighting, such as sunlight, creates realistic shadows and highlights. Consider adding dynamic lighting if the car is moving between different environments.
Background and Set Design: Add details like buildings, trees, streetlights, or other elements to make the scene feel alive.
3. Animation
Movement: Smooth car movements, including acceleration, turning, and braking, should follow realistic physics.
Suspension Dynamics: The suspension should react to road conditions, such as bumps, turns, and acceleration.
Tire Interaction: Ensure tires rotate, skid, and interact with the ground realistically, including any dirt or debris kicking up.
4. VFX (Visual Effects)
Smoke and Dust: When the car accelerates, drifts, or brakes, adding smoke and dust particles can enhance realism.
Rain/Snow Effects: If the environment includes weather effects, ensure the car reacts accordingly, with water or snow splashing up.
Explosions/Collisions: For action scenes, you can add explosions, debris, and damage effects to the car and surroundings.
Lighting Effects: Headlights, taillights, and any additional lighting from the car or environment should be accurately simulated.
5. Sound Design (Optional)
Engine Sounds: Sync the sound of the car's engine with its movements and actions.
Environmental Sounds: Add ambient sounds such as city noise, wind, or tire screeching to enhance the atmosphere.
6. Rendering
Realistic Rendering: Use ray tracing or other advanced rendering techniques to capture realistic reflections, refractions, and lighting in the scene.
Compositing: Combine all elements in post-production to ensure seamless integration of the car model with the environment and VFX.
7. Software
Modeling and Animation: Software like Blender, Maya, or 3ds Max.
VFX and Compositing: Houdini, After Effects, or Nuke.
Rendering: Arnold, V-Ray, or Cycles for high-quality output.
